A footwear shop owner shot a woman relative and himself here Wednesday after she refused to marry him, police said. Both were critically wounded.
Deepak, 25, targeted Renu, 25, a grocer's daughter, with a pistol around 4.30 p.m. in Daulatpura neighbourhood.
The two are cousins and their families were opposed to their marriage. Deepak, however, wanted Renu to marry him.
On Wednesday, Deepak again proposed to her but she refused. Suddenly, he whipped out a pistol and fired at her back before shooting himself in the neck.
Senior Superintendent of Police Dharmendra Singh Yadav said: "The first priority is to save them."
